Description
Career Evolutions is looking for a HR Coordinator for a financial company in Chandler AZ. Contract to hire arrangement with pay that is DOE (depends on experience).

BASIC FUNCTION:
The Human Resources Coordinator is responsible for providing administrative and project support to all areas of the Human Resources department as needed.  This position will interact with various business leaders, business units, employees, and outside vendors. 
 
JOB DUTIES:
  • Orders departmental supplies and maintains the HR supply closet.
  • Distributes mail.
  • Coordinates travel as needed.
  • Responsible for conducting Exit Interviews and sending termination letters.
  • Maintain the public facing HR SharePoint site.
  • Manages vendor relations with but not limited to office supply, hotel sales, and catering vendors.
  • Set up and breakdown of large meetings and department events.
  • Schedules conferences and training rooms.       
  • Maintain confidentiality in regards to team member information and records.               
  • Provide project management support for various Human Resources projects and programs.
  • Assists with various charitable events throughout the year.
  • Acts as back-up to all other department coordinators and HR Connection.
  • Responsible for quarterly birthday and anniversary celebration.
  • Perform other various office and administrative duties as needed.  
  • Assist HR leaders and staff with various tasks as assigned.
